Parklife 2025: Manchester’s Biggest Party Returns with Charli XCX and 50 Cent as Headliners
=====================================================================================

Manchester’s Heaton Park is set to host the highly anticipated Parklife festival in 2025, with tens of thousands of music lovers expected to attend the two-day event. According to The Manc, this year’s festival promises to be the biggest in years, with huge headline slots from Charli XCX and 50 Cent, as well as performances from festival favourites like Bicep, Pawsa, and Confidence Man.

The festival, which is considered one of the biggest parties of the year in Manchester, will take place on Saturday, June 14, and Sunday, June 15, at Heaton Park. Gates will open from midday on Saturday and 1 pm on Sunday, with the event finishing at 11 pm on both days. Last entry to the festival is strictly 5 pm. As reported by The Manc, Parklife 2025 will feature a star-studded line-up, including soul singer Jorja Smith, Parklife favourite Peggy Gou, and Mancs like Interplanetary Criminal, Antony Szmierek, and Morgan Seatree.

A Line-up Fit for a Festival
—————————–

The Parklife 2025 line-up is impressive, with two huge headliners in Charli XCX and 50 Cent. Other notable acts include Bicep, Pawsa, Overmono, Confidence Man, Hybrid Minds, Rudimental, and Chris Stussy. Unfortunately, one of the hottest names on the bill, Lola Young, has pulled out of the festival this year. However, the line-up is still shaping up to be a massive weekend. The Manc reports that tickets for Parklife are still on sale, with decent availability for most ticket types.

Ticket Prices and Availability
——————————

Tickets for Parklife 2025 are still available, with prices ranging from £95.20 for a Saturday or Sunday day ticket to £164.45 for a weekend ticket. VIP weekend tickets are available for £218.90, while VIP day tickets cost £137.50. Those who have already purchased a ticket can upgrade to VIP for £72.80 for the whole weekend or £44.80 for a day ticket. As per The Manc, the VIP area will be located on the other side of the festival site this year, near the Valley Stage.

Travel and Transportation
————————-

The festival takes place at Heaton Park, which is a little way out of the city centre. However, The Manc reports that the festival still advises using the dedicated shuttle bus to get there and back, which is the quickest and easiest route. The shuttle bus leaves from Lever Street in the Northern Quarter and will drop you right outside the festival site within about 30 minutes. Alternatively, you can get a Bee Network tram to Bowker Vale or Heaton Park tram stops and walk up to the gates.

Festival Map and Stages
———————–

There are some big changes on site at Parklife this year, including the introduction of two new stages, Matinee and Big Top. The Valley will act as the main stage, while Magic Sky will move to a more central location. The Hangar stage will dominate the western side of the event, and at the top of the hill will be the small but mighty G Stage. What to Bring and What Not to Bring
————————————–

There is strict security in place getting in and out of Heaton Park for Parklife festival, for everyone’s safety. The Manc advises that you can bring your own water bottle on site with refill stations all over Parklife, but it mustn’t be larger than 500ml and can’t be metal. You can also take sun cream as long as it’s 200ml or less and in original containers. However, there is a long list of prohibited items, including alcohol, drugs, knives, aerosols, and flares/fireworks.
